Yankees Joe Torre should not be fired!

By: Jason Cunningham (10/05/2005)

  It is almost laughable to think that Yankees skipper Joe Torre could be fired. The man who has won four  Baseball World Championships in his tenure as manager of the New York team has been nothing less than consistent, year after year. He has coached the same team since 1995, and made six trips to the World Series.

 In our hearts we all want to be winners. Joe Torre is associated with those winners who are able to make their mark in New York City. His name is as synonymous with the city as former mayor Rudy Giuliani.  Anybody who questions his ability to coach should look at all the banners the Yankees hoisted during the 1980's and early 1990's, when he was not the manager. They won nothing, and unless you were conscious in the 1970's then you forgot about Yankees' pride or greatness.

 Torre belongs in the white and pinstripes of the Yankees. In the last eight years his team has been in five World Series and won three of them. This does not sound like a record of mediocrity or one that should cause owner George Steinbrenner to make a change! Maybe if King George of New York had kept pitchers Rogers Clemens and Andy Pettitte, then the Yankees would not have been absent from the World Series the last two years, but still they made the playoffs without a true pitching ace.  If Torre does not return to New York in  2006, he will be the number one prospect for any general manager in the universe!
